2026 Idaho Goldback 1/4000 Troy Ounce 24K Gold Note Low Mintage Rare
This 2026 Idaho Goldback is a remarkable piece of currency innovation, featuring 1/4000th troy ounce of 24K gold physically embedded within a durable polymer note. As a 2026 issue, this item is considered part of a limited mintage, making it a rare and hard-to-get addition for any collector of precious metals or unique currency. The design prominently features the figure of Justitia, representing Justice, with the inscription Judge Righteously. These Goldbacks serve as a privately issued negotiable instrument and are prized for their intricate artwork and fractional gold content. Being a 2026 release, its availability is restricted, adding significant appeal for those seeking low mintage contemporary gold bullion products.
2025 Florida 2 Goldback 1/500 Troy Ounce 24K Gold Aurum Note
Condition: This item appears to be in uncirculated, pristine condition with sharp corners, straight edges, and no visible signs of folding, creasing, or handling wear. The gold surface retains a high reflective luster. It was produced by Valaurum using the proprietary Aurum process for Goldback Inc. The metal content is confirmed as 1/500 troy ounce of 24K gold. Historically, the Goldback is a local, voluntary currency launched to provide a physical gold medium for small transactions, with this specific 2025 Florida series featuring the personification of Fortitudo (Fortitude) alongside indigenous and ecological imagery including a Seminole woman and a manatee. The strike type is a vacuum deposition thin-film gold process rather than a traditional mint strike. The item is raw and ungraded.
